Key Factors for Choosing Stairwell Emergency Light

When selecting a Stairwell emergency light for high-flow passageways, battery technology is the most critical factor. LiFePO4 lithium batteries provide improved energy consumption, product reliability, and lifetime compared to traditional batteries. The voyager Emergency Blade Exit Sign uses a LiFePO4 3.2V 1800mAh battery, ensuring consistent performance even after repeated charge cycles. The Warehouse emergency light Guard Fit Downlight offers multiple battery capacities from 1500mAh to 3400mAh, allowing you to select the right backup for your traffic volume. Discharge duration is equally important — both products guarantee 3 hours or more of continuous illumination. Test Mode and Long-Term Reliability

For long-lasting performance, the Stairwell emergency light must support regular testing. Both IMIGY Lighting products support manual test, self-test, and DALI-2 test modes. The Warehouse emergency light voyager sign with self-test mode automatically runs routine checks, reducing maintenance workload. The Building emergency light Guard Fit downlight with DALI-2 communication integrates with building management systems for centralized monitoring.
